Zakir Hussain's Family: All About Ustad's Wife, His Two Daughters

Tabla maestro Zakir Hussain passed away at the age of 73 due to heart-related complications. His close friend and flautist, Rakesh Chaurasia, stated on Sunday that the musician had been admitted to the ICU of a San Francisco hospital.

Zakir Hussain's Family

Hussain was married to Antonia Minnecola, a Kathak dancer and teacher, who also served as his manager. Antonia, an Italian-American, met Zakir in California's Bay Area in the late 1970s when she was in the early stages of her dance training. The couple had two daughters, Anisa Qureshi and Isabella Qureshi.

Anisa, the elder daughter, graduated from UCLA and is now a filmmaker, known for '3:10 to Yuma' (2007), 'Mr. Woodcock' (2007), and 'Just Like Heaven' (2005). The younger daughter, Isabella, is currently studying dance in Manhattan.

Hussain had two brothers: Taufiq Qureshi, a percussionist, and Fazal Qureshi, a tabla player. Their other brother, Munawar, tragically passed away at a young age following an attack by a rabid dog.

His eldest sister, Bilquis, died before Hussain's birth. Another sister, Razia, passed away due to complications from cataract surgery, just hours before the death of their father in 2000. Hussain is also survived by another sister, Khurshid.

Zakir Hussain's Death

According to an earlier report by PTI, the 73-year-old musician had been suffering from blood pressure-related issues before his passing.
